Read Psalm 148

vv7-12  Praise the Lord from the earth, you creatures of the ocean depths,
fire and hail, snow and clouds wind and weather that obey him,
mountains and all hills, fruit trees and all cedars, 

wild animals and all livestock, small scurrying animals and birds,
kings of the earth and all people, rulers and judges of the earth,
young men and young women, old men and children.

To round off our brief series looking at Creation we come to this Psalm that calls on everything that has been created to praise God. His character and creative power is cause for celebration – His purpose in creation is to bring honour and glory to His own name.

To be in step with His purpose we find we need two clear aims.

First – our own lives should bring honour to Him. We offer Him the worship of obedience to His will, and of love that reflects His own character of love.

Second – we give respect to the whole of creation. There can be no excuse for destructive or abusive behaviour towards our fellow humans, the animal kingdom or the material substance of this universe which God has made. 

None of this is to say that Earth will continue as it is for ever! God’s plan for the whole of creation is Renewal – turn on and read 2 Peter 3. The personal challenge is unavoidable. ‘ But we are looking forward to the new heavens and new earth he has promised, a world filled with God’s righteousness. And so, dear friends, while you are waiting for these things to happen, make every effort to be found living peaceful lives that are pure and blameless in his sight.
